Inflammation may be the basis of a variety of diseases, including cancer, neurodegenerative brain disorders, diabetes, and cardiovascular disease. Oatmeal contains avenanthramides that reduce inflammation and improve overall cell function. These compounds are part of the oat plant’s response to environmental stressors; in humans, they act as antioxidants, reducing inflammation.
